James W. DeMile (1938 – August 15, 2021[1]) was an American martial artist and author. He was among the first group of students of Bruce Lee,[2][3] whom he met in 1959, as they both attended Edison Technical School.[4] In 1963, DeMile appeared in Lee's only book, The Philosophical Art of Self Defense. He was an inductee in the AMAA Who's Who in the Martial Arts Hall of Fame and Black Belt Magazine Hall of Fame.[5][6][7]
